Researchers at Stanford Introduce RoboFuME: Revolutionizing Robotic Learning with Minimal Human Input

Marktechpost

In many domains that involve machine learning, a widely successful paradigm for learning task-specific models is to first pre-train a general-purpose model from an existing diverse prior dataset and then adapt the model with a small addition of task-specific data. This paradigm is attractive to real-world robot learning since collecting data on a robot is expensive, and fine-tuning an existing model on a small task-specific dataset could substantially improve the data efficiency for learning a n

Beyond Fact or Fiction: Evaluating the Advanced Fact-Checking Capabilities of Large Language Models like GPT-4

Marktechpost

Researchers from the University of Zurich focus on the role of Large Language Models (LLMs) like GPT-4 in autonomous fact-checking, evaluating their ability to phrase queries, retrieve contextual data, and make decisions while providing explanations and citations. Results indicate that LLMs, particularly GPT-4, perform well with contextual information, but accuracy varies based on query language and claim veracity.

Meet Davidsonian Scene Graph: A Revolutionary AI Framework for Assessing Text-to-Image AI with Precision

Marktechpost

Text-to-image (T2I) models are difficult to evaluate and often rely on question generation and answering (QG/A) methods to assess text-image faithfulness. However, current QG/A methods have issues with reliability, such as the quality of questions and consistency of answers. In response, researchers have introduced the Davidsonian Scene Graph (DSG), an automatic QG/A framework inspired by formal semantics.
